Whatever the material, uPVC windows may need to be fixed and maintained periodically. While these windows are well-known for their endurance and resistance to extreme weather conditions however, their design and moving parts may wear out over time. If they are not taken care of, minor problems could become major issues that stop the window from operating correctly. To prevent stains, UPVC windows require regular cleaning. To keep your frames clean, use warm water and a soft cloth. Avoid using abrasive cleaners since they could scratch the surface. A hardware store may sell a special uPVC cleaner. Make sure you purchase one that is specifically made for this particular material, as it will not damage the silicone seals on your windows.

There are uPVC windows that have built-in mechanisms that can wear out over time. These windows feature hinges, springs and other moving parts which can become brittle when not maintained. Although you might believe that uPVC windows are extremely tough they aren't the situation. They need to be maintained, even if they don’t leak. If they aren't addressed quickly minor issues could transform into major ones.
